Ducati Hypermotard 950 vs Honda Africa Twin

Do you want to find out which bike is the best, Ducati Hypermotard 950 or Honda Africa Twin? 91Wheels brings you a detailed comparison between Hypermotard 950 and Africa Twin. Ducati Hypermotard 950 Price starts at Rs.16.00 Lakh (ex-showroom) for RVE and Honda Africa Twin Price starts at Rs.16.02 Lakh (ex-showroom) for MT. Ducati Hypermotard 950 can generate 112.4 bhp @ 9000 rpm power whereas Honda Africa Twin is a 2 cylinder, 1082 cc Engine can generate 97.89 bhp @ 7500 rpm power. In terms of mileage, Hypermotard 950 provides a mileage of 19.6 kmpl (base model), and Africa Twin has a mileage of 20.8 kmpl (base model). Ducati Hypermotard 950 is available in 4 colours & 2 variants whereas Honda Africa Twin is available in 1 colours & 2 variants.
